Cost to ship a car from Baton Rouge to Orlando

Quick answer: The average cost to ship a car 703 miles from Baton Rouge to Orlando ranges from $842 to $1,290. Depending on factors like the transport type and season, you can expect your vehicle to land in Orlando, FL in 1–6 days. For a more detailed quote, use our car shipping cost calculator.

Factors affecting Baton Rouge to Orlando car shipping costs

Companies base their car shipping costs on a variety of factors. When transporting your vehicle from Baton Rouge to Orlando, these factors will influence the cost:

Type of transport

There are different options for transporting your car from Baton Rouge to Orlando, such as open, enclosed, or top-loaded transport, each catering to specific needs. When leaving Baton Rouge, open carriers are the most cost-effective option, while enclosed transport provides added protection for luxury or classic cars. If you’re uncertain which option to use to get your vehicle to Orlando, refer to our guide comparing open vs. enclosed car shipping.

Vehicle size and type

The size and weight of your vehicle play a crucial role in determining shipping costs out of Baton Rouge. Larger and heavier vehicles are more expensive to ship. For instance, shipping a large SUV to Orlando will cost more than a compact car due to the additional space and weight.

Distance and route

The distance from the Red Stick to the City Beautiful — approximately 703 miles — directly influences fuel and labor costs. The longer the journey, the higher the cost.

Time of the year

The season and weather in both Baton Rouge and Orlando can impact car shipping prices.

Best months to plan a move to Baton rouge are April, October and November as these are these month have more favorable weather, while July and August are the least comfortable months which can cause discomfort during a move.

Orlando has two basic seasons, a hot and rainy season, lasting from May until late October, and a warm and dry season from November through April.

During peak times like summer and the winter holidays, demand for car shipping services increases, leading to higher prices. Shipping your car from Baton Rouge to Orlando during these peak seasons can result in higher costs due to increased demand.

Fuel prices

Fuel price fluctuations can greatly influence transport costs. This is a critical factor given the 703-mile distance between Baton Rouge and Orlando and the varying fuel prices across different regions. When fuel prices are high, shipping costs will rise accordingly.

Delivery expectations

Being flexible with your delivery dates can sometimes lead to discounts from your auto shipper. However, shipping a car from Baton Rouge to Orlando typically takes between 1 and 6 days. Flexibility in delivery times can save costs, whereas expedited services ensure quicker delivery but at a premium cost.

Comparing Baton Rouge and Orlando vehicle regulations

Parking permits

  • Baton Rouge: There are some areas that require a parking permit. Make sure you have inquired if one is needed in the area where you are moving. Please inquire for the requirements for residential parking, You may visit their website: https://www.brla.gov/297/Spanish-Town-Parking-District-Regulation
  • Orlando: On-Street Metered Spaces $1 per hour Free from 6 p.m. - 8 a.m.

Car insurance requirements

  • Baton Rouge: The insurance limit represents the maximum payout for a claim, and in Louisiana, the minimum liability limits are $15,000 for bodily injury per person, $30,000 for bodily injury per accident, and $25,000 for property damage; these limits can be raised beyond the state-mandated minimums.
  • Orlando: All vehicles registered in Florida must have PIP and PDL insurance coverage at the time of registration with a minimum of $10,000 for PIP and $10,000 for PDL.

Vehicle inspections

  • Baton Rouge: In Louisiana, the annual safety and emissions inspection includes checks on the vehicle's safety equipment, anti-tampering of emissions systems, and a test on the integrity of the gas cap.
  • Orlando: Unlike many states, Florida does not mandate vehicle owners to undergo regular emission or safety inspections for their vehicles.

Driver’s license

  • Baton Rouge: New residents in Louisiana must transfer their out-of-state driver's license within 30 days of establishing residency in the state.
  • Orlando: If you possess a valid driver's license from another state, you are legally permitted to drive in Florida without obtaining a Florida driver's license. However, if you choose to obtain one, you only need to pass a vision and hearing test, no written or road test is necessary.
